Fitur Global Replicator dari ApsaraMQ for RocketMQ memungkinkan Anda mengumpulkan statistik terkait pesan masuk, pesan keluar, dan pesan yang telah diproses dalam tugas sinkronisasi data. Anda juga dapat mengonfigurasi aturan peringatan di CloudMonitor untuk memantau metrik tugas sinkronisasi data. Jika ambang batas tertentu tercapai, CloudMonitor akan mengirimkan notifikasi peringatan kepada kontak yang ditentukan.
Informasi latar belakang
Fitur Global Replicator dari ApsaraMQ for RocketMQ diimplementasikan berdasarkan EventBridge. Saat Anda menambahkan pemetaan topik dan mengaktifkan sinkronisasi kemajuan konsumen untuk tugas Global Replicator, aliran acara secara otomatis dibuat di EventBridge di wilayah tempat tugas tersebut berada.
Anda dapat melihat detail berbagai metrik terkait aliran acara yang dibuat, termasuk jumlah acara masuk, jumlah acara keluar, waktu respons hilir dari aliran acara, dan jumlah acara yang telah diproses. Anda juga dapat mengonfigurasi aturan peringatan untuk memantau metrik aliran acara. Saat ambang batas yang dikonfigurasi dalam aturan tercapai, sistem secara otomatis mengirimkan notifikasi untuk memberi tahu Anda tentang anomali.
Lihat metrik
Masuk ke Konsol EventBridge. Di panel navigasi kiri, klik Event Streams.
Di bilah navigasi atas, pilih wilayah tempat aliran acara yang ingin Anda kelola berada. Kemudian, temukan aliran acara dan klik namanya.
Di panel navigasi kiri halaman yang muncul, klik Metric Monitoring.
Di halaman Metric Monitoring, lihat metrik pemantauan berikut:
Number of Inbound Events in Event Stream(count/s)
Jumlah Acara Masuk dalam Aliran Acara: jumlah acara masuk ke aliran acara per satuan waktu.
output_data(count/s)
Output_data_success: jumlah acara yang berhasil diteruskan ke sistem hilir.
Output_data_fail: jumlah acara yang gagal diteruskan ke sistem hilir.
Downstream Response Time of Event Stream(ms)
Waktu Respons Hilir Aliran Acara: waktu respons yang diperlukan oleh target acara setelah acara dikirim ke target acara.
Processing capacity(count/s)
Filter_data_success: jumlah acara yang cocok berdasarkan kondisi yang ditentukan.
Filter_data_fail: jumlah acara yang tidak cocok berdasarkan kondisi filter yang ditentukan.
CatatanSecara default, Konsol EventBridge menampilkan data metrik dalam satu jam terakhir. Anda dapat memilih rentang waktu di bagian atas halaman sesuai dengan kebutuhan bisnis Anda.
Anda dapat mengklik ikon
di sebelah kanan metrik untuk memperbesar grafik dan melihat detail metrik pemantauan.
Buat aturan peringatan
Masuk ke Konsol EventBridge. Di panel navigasi kiri, klik Event Streams.
Di bilah navigasi atas, pilih wilayah tempat aliran acara yang ingin Anda kelola berada. Kemudian, temukan aliran acara dan klik namanya.
Di panel navigasi kiri halaman yang muncul, klik Metric Monitoring.
Di pojok kanan atas halaman Metric Monitoring, klik ikon
lalu klik Configure Alert Rules. Di halaman Alert Rules di konsol CloudMonitor, klik Create Alert Rule.Di panel Create Alert Rule, konfigurasikan parameter yang diperlukan dan klik Confirm. Tabel berikut menjelaskan parameter tersebut.
Parameter
Deskripsi
Contoh
Product
Produk untuk mana Anda ingin mengonfigurasi aturan peringatan. Pilih EventStreaming.
EventStreaming
Resource Range
Rentang sumber daya. Pilih All Resources.
Semua Sumber Daya
Rule Description
Klik Add Rule dan pilih jenis metrik dari daftar drop-down.
Di panel Configure Rule Description, masukkan nama aturan di bidang Alert Rule dan konfigurasikan parameter Tipe Metrik. Nilai valid untuk parameter Tipe Metrik:
Simple Metric: Pilih metrik dan konfigurasikan ambang batas serta tingkat peringatan untuk metrik tersebut.
Combined Metrics: Pilih tingkat peringatan dan tentukan ekspresi peringatan.
CatatanJika Anda mengonfigurasi beberapa aturan peringatan, Anda harus mengonfigurasi parameter Relationship Between Metrics. Nilai valid:
Hasilkan peringatan jika semua metrik memenuhi kondisi (&&): Peringatan hanya dipicu jika kondisi yang ditentukan untuk semua aturan peringatan yang dikonfigurasi terpenuhi.
Hasilkan peringatan jika salah satu kondisi terpenuhi (||): Peringatan dipicu jika kondisi yang ditentukan untuk salah satu aturan peringatan yang dikonfigurasi terpenuhi.
Expression: Pilih tingkat peringatan dan kemudian konfigurasikan ekspresi peringatan.
Dynamic Threshold: Untuk informasi lebih lanjut tentang ambang batas dinamis, lihat Ikhtisar dan Buat aturan peringatan yang dipicu oleh ambang batas dinamis.
Klik OK.
CatatanUntuk informasi tentang cara menentukan ekspresi aturan peringatan yang kompleks, lihat Ekspresi aturan peringatan.
Nama Aturan: demo
Tipe Metrik: Metrik Sederhana
Metrik: eventStreaming input events
Tingkat Peringatan: Peringatan(Warn)
Ambang Batas: 1000 jumlah
Mute For
Interval saat CloudMonitor akan mengirim ulang notifikasi peringatan jika peringatan belum dibersihkan. Nilai valid: 1 Menit, 5 Menit, 15 Menit, 30 Menit, 60 Menit, 3 Jam, 6 Jam, 12 Jam, dan 24 Jam.
Jika nilai ambang batas terlampaui, CloudMonitor mengirimkan notifikasi peringatan. Jika nilai ambang batas terlampaui lagi dalam periode bisu, CloudMonitor tidak akan mengirim ulang notifikasi peringatan. Jika peringatan belum dibersihkan ketika periode bisu berakhir, CloudMonitor akan mengirim ulang notifikasi peringatan.
15 Menit
Effective Period
Periode selama aturan peringatan efektif. CloudMonitor mengirimkan notifikasi peringatan berdasarkan aturan peringatan hanya dalam periode efektif.
CatatanJika aturan peringatan tidak efektif, tidak ada notifikasi peringatan yang dikirim. Namun, catatan peringatan masih ditampilkan di tab Alert History.
Mulai Pada: 00:00
Berakhir Pada: 23:59
Siklus: Senin hingga Minggu
Tag
Tag yang ingin Anda tambahkan ke aturan peringatan. Tag terdiri dari kunci tag dan nilai tag.
CatatanAnda dapat menambahkan hingga enam tag ke aturan peringatan.
Kunci Tag: key
Nilai Tag: value
Alert Contact Group
Grup kontak ke mana notifikasi peringatan dikirim.
Notifikasi peringatan grup aplikasi dikirim ke kontak yang termasuk dalam grup kontak yang ditentukan. Grup kontak peringatan mencakup satu atau lebih kontak peringatan.
Untuk informasi tentang cara membuat kontak peringatan dan grup kontak peringatan, lihat Buat kontak peringatan atau grup kontak peringatan.
test
Alert Callback
URL panggilan balik yang dapat diakses melalui Internet. CloudMonitor mengirimkan permintaan POST untuk mendorong notifikasi peringatan ke URL panggilan balik yang ditentukan. Hanya panggilan balik HTTP yang didukung. Untuk informasi tentang cara mengonfigurasi panggilan balik peringatan, lihat Gunakan fitur panggilan balik peringatan untuk mengirim notifikasi tentang peringatan yang dipicu oleh ambang batas.
Untuk menguji konektivitas URL panggilan balik peringatan, lakukan langkah-langkah berikut:
Klik Test di sebelah URL panggilan balik.
Di panel tes Webhook, Anda dapat memeriksa dan menyelesaikan masalah konektivitas URL panggilan balik peringatan berdasarkan kode status dan detail hasil tes yang dikembalikan.
CatatanUntuk mendapatkan detail hasil tes, konfigurasikan parameter Test Template Type dan Language dan klik Test.
Di pesan yang muncul, klik Close.
CatatanParameter ini berada di bagian Advanced Settings.
http://alert.aliyun.com:8080/callback
Push Channel
Nilai valid:
Auto Scaling: Jika Anda mengaktifkan Auto Scaling, aturan penskalaan yang ditentukan dipicu saat peringatan dihasilkan. Untuk informasi tentang cara membuat grup penskalaan dan mengonfigurasi aturan penskalaan, lihat Kelola grup penskalaan dan Konfigurasikan aturan penskalaan.
Log Service: Jika Anda mengaktifkan Log Service, informasi peringatan ditulis ke Logstore yang ditentukan di Simple Log Service saat peringatan dihasilkan. Untuk informasi tentang cara membuat proyek dan Logstore, lihat Memulai cepat: Gunakan Logtail untuk mengumpulkan dan menganalisis log teks ECS.
Simple Message Queue (sebelumnya MNS) - Topik: Jika Anda mengaktifkan Simple Message Queue (formerly MNS) - Topic, informasi peringatan ditulis ke topik yang ditentukan di Simple Message Queue (sebelumnya MNS) saat peringatan dihasilkan. Untuk informasi tentang cara membuat topik, lihat Buat topik.
Function Compute: Jika Anda mengaktifkan Function Compute, notifikasi peringatan dikirim ke Function Compute untuk pemrosesan format saat peringatan dihasilkan. Untuk informasi tentang cara membuat layanan dan fungsi, lihat Buat fungsi dengan cepat.
Auto Scaling
Method to handle alarms when no monitoring data is found
Metode yang digunakan untuk menangani peringatan saat tidak ada data pemantauan yang ditemukan. Nilai valid:
Do not do anything (default)
Send alert notifications
Treated as normal
CatatanAnda dapat mengonfigurasi parameter ini di bagian Advanced Settings.
Tidak melakukan apa pun